A Professional Certificate in Carbon Fiber Applications in Automotive Engineering provides specialized training in the design, manufacturing, and application of carbon fiber reinforced polymers (CFRP) within the automotive industry. This intensive program equips participants with a deep understanding of material properties, processing techniques, and quality control measures crucial for successful carbon fiber integration.
Learning outcomes typically include proficiency in finite element analysis (FEA) for composite structures, advanced knowledge of different carbon fiber manufacturing processes like autoclave molding and resin transfer molding (RTM), and a comprehensive understanding of the lifecycle assessment of carbon fiber composites, addressing sustainability concerns. Graduates will be adept at designing lightweight and high-strength automotive components.
The duration of such a certificate program varies, but generally ranges from several months to a year, depending on the intensity and depth of the curriculum. The program often involves a blend of theoretical coursework and hands-on laboratory sessions, providing practical experience working with carbon fiber materials.
